9. Conclusion
Air pollution has significant effects on health and the environment. In France, despite an upward trend in air quality over the last twenty years, limit values are still not respected everywhere, although it should not be forgotten that pollution is transboundary. Today, air pollution is a major environmental concern for the French. Growing awareness of the environmental and health impacts caused by deteriorating air quality in both urban and rural areas is leading decision-makers to impose new constraints on the sectors that emit the most pollutants. The French Energy Transition Bill provides for targets to be set in the national plan to reduce pollutant emissions (PREPA) by 2030.
